Output 0d06bba868768f33295bbcc1f8be3f404530775d811285cbb230887eac138816:73

value
33248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b90ba57a6de9527b89e79ad12a4d965836a6e6a OP_EQUAL
address
3Fsa39YxtiQQHnDbpmzkFXvzN1NxzYqjkA
transaction
0d06bba868768f33295bbcc1f8be3f404530775d811285cbb230887eac138816
spent
true